Blender高效导出帧数设置详解:从新手到高手251


Blender是一款功能强大的开源3D建模、动画和渲染软件,其强大的功能也带来了相对复杂的设置。对于动画制作来说,正确设置导出帧数至关重要,这直接影响最终视频的播放速度和流畅度。本文将详细讲解Blender中如何设置导出帧数,并涵盖一些常见的误区和高级技巧,帮助您从新手到高手,高效完成动画导出。

一、理解帧率 (FPS) 和帧数

在开始设置之前,我们需要明确两个关键概念:帧率 (Frames Per Second,FPS) 和帧数。帧率是指每秒钟显示的图像帧数,它决定了动画的流畅度。例如,24 FPS 的动画看起来比较电影化,而 60 FPS 的动画则更流畅,适合游戏或快速动作场景。帧数指的是动画的总帧数,例如一个10秒钟,帧率为24 FPS的动画,总帧数就是 240 (10秒 * 24帧/秒)。

二、Blender中的帧率设置

Blender的帧率设置主要在两个地方进行:项目设置和渲染设置。两者都必须一致才能确保最终导出的视频帧率正确。

1. 项目设置 (Project Settings):

这是设置Blender项目全局帧率的地方。在Blender主界面,点击菜单栏的“文件” -> “用户设置” -> “系统”。在右侧的“场景”选项卡中,找到“帧率”选项,这里默认是24 FPS,您可以根据需要更改为其他值,例如25 FPS、30 FPS或60 FPS。修改后,记得点击“保存用户设置”按钮保存更改。这将影响整个项目的帧率。

2. 渲染设置 (Render Settings):

即使在项目设置中正确设置了帧率,渲染设置中的帧率也必须一致。在Blender主界面,点击“渲染属性”面板(通常在右下角,快捷键是F10)。在“渲染”选项卡中,找到“帧率”选项。确保这里的帧率与项目设置中的帧率相同。任何不一致都会导致最终视频播放速度错误。

三、导出视频的帧率设置

在渲染完成之后,您需要将Blender生成的图像序列或视频文件导出。这里也有需要注意的地方,确保导出设置与项目和渲染设置一致。 Blender支持多种视频格式导出,例如MP4、AVI、MOV等。不同的导出方式和格式,设置也略有不同。

1. 通过视频编辑器导出:

Blender自带的视频编辑器可以方便地将渲染好的图像序列合成视频。导入序列后,在输出设置中选择目标格式和帧率,确保与项目设置和渲染设置一致。

2. 使用外部编码器导出:

许多用户更喜欢使用专业的视频编码器(例如FFmpeg, Handbrake)来处理最终的视频文件,以获得更好的质量和压缩效率。此时,您需要先在Blender中渲染出图像序列(例如png或jpg格式),然后使用外部编码器将图像序列合成视频,并在编码器的设置中指定帧率。

四、常见问题和解决方法

1. 导出视频速度错误: 这是最常见的问题,通常是由于项目设置、渲染设置和导出设置中的帧率不一致造成的。仔细检查这三个地方的帧率是否一致,确保它们都设置为目标帧率。

2. 视频播放卡顿: 如果视频播放卡顿,可能是因为渲染的帧率过高,电脑配置不足以流畅播放。尝试降低帧率或优化渲染设置,例如降低分辨率或使用更简单的渲染引擎。

3. 导出视频格式选择: 选择合适的视频格式也很重要。MP4格式广泛兼容,压缩效率高;AVI格式兼容性也比较好;MOV格式则通常用于苹果设备。根据您的需求选择合适的格式。

五、高级技巧

1. 使用帧步长(Frame Step)控制渲染帧数: 如果您只想渲染部分帧,可以使用帧步长。在渲染设置中,可以设置帧步长,例如设置为2,则Blender只渲染奇数帧,从而减少渲染时间,但会降低动画流畅度。这在预览或测试时非常有用。

2. 结合视频编辑器进行后期处理: Blender的视频编辑器可以进行简单的视频编辑,例如添加字幕、音效等。可以将渲染好的视频导入视频编辑器进行后期处理,从而获得更完善的最终作品。

3. 利用外部软件进行高级视频处理: 对于更复杂的视频编辑和后期处理需求,您可以考虑使用专业的视频编辑软件,例如Adobe Premiere Pro, DaVinci Resolve等,以获得更好的效果。

通过以上步骤和技巧,您将能够在Blender中高效地设置导出帧数,并制作出流畅、高质量的动画视频。记住,一致性是关键!确保项目设置、渲染设置和导出设置中的帧率保持一致,才能避免常见的错误。

2025-03-04


上一篇:CorelDRAW自动闭合路径及形状的技巧与方法详解

下一篇:Blender视图切换与操控:从新手到熟练